## Sensor drift: what to do at 3am

If the GrowLoop controller starts reporting humidity swings that don't match the backup probes in the Fernwick greenhouse, it's almost always sensor drift, not an actual climate event. Don't panic and don't touch the vents manually. First, restart the calibration daemon and give it ten minutes to re-baseline. If readings still disagree by more than 5%, flip the controller into safe mode. The safe-mode thresholds it will use are these.

config for yahap-bajof:
[istix]
host = istix.qorvelsys.internal
user = istix_svc
database = istix_prod

// Setup for the Fernhollow flag-rollout client.
// This client polls the rollout coordinator every 30s; do not
// shorten the interval, as the coordinator rate-limits aggressively
// and a throttled poll will freeze flag states mid-rollout.
// If flags appear stuck during an incident, restart this client
// before touching the coordinator itself.
// Initialize with the service key that follows.

service key, fawip-bajef: kto11_Qt5wZK9vdNC

### Changelog — Tilegrub prefetcher defaults

Quick heads-up for the sync: we changed Tilegrub's default prefetch behavior. It used to grab two zoom levels around the viewport, which hammered the tile cache on slow connections. New defaults prefetch one level and back off under packet loss. Most folks won't notice except lower bandwidth bills. The new default configuration ships as follows.

service settings:
[casax]
port = 6379
team = rusir
host = casax.zemvarhq.corp
region = outer-4
access_code = ac_9808ce
timeout_ms = 1500

Key ceremony checklist — item 7. Verify the Lintvault static-analysis baseline file matches the signed copy from the Marrowgate vault before unlocking. Reviewer confirms hash parity, no suppressions added since the last ceremony, and that the baseline was regenerated on an air-gapped host. Reject the ceremony if any suppression lacks a ticket reference. Once parity is confirmed, unseal the envelope and read the recovery passphrase below.

vault phrase of kafog-kahif = holdor-rusir-praox